In the present paper we investigate in how far stars with an initial mass larger than 40 M affect the chemical enrichment ( of the Galaxy. We illustrate the importance for chemical yields of a most up-to-date treatment of the various stellar wind mass loss episodes in stellar evolutionary codes and
